What is IoT edge computing and what are its main benefits?

Social Studies
1 answer:
Novay_Z [31]2 years ago
6 0

Edge computing can enable processing and filtering of IoT generated data closer to the devices, optimising bandwidth by ensuring that only data needed for longer term storage or analysis is streamed to a centralised management platform.

Individuals high in conscientiousness are more likely to experience optimal aging, including positive affect, life satisfaction, and positive

Being cautious or diligent is a personality attribute known as conscientiousness. Conscientiousness implies a desire to complete a task well and a serious attitude toward one's social obligations. Instead of being loose and disorganized, conscientious people are typically effective and well-organized. They tend to be reliable, show self-control, behave honorably, and strive for success. They also exhibit planned behavior as opposed to impulsive action. It shows itself in typical actions like being orderly and methodical, as well as qualities like being meticulous, thorough, and deliberate (the tendency to think carefully before acting).
